Junipine Resort is a 4-star retreat nestled in the scenic Oak Creek Canyon, featuring upscale creekhomes with wood-burning fireplaces and private wraparound decks. This Sedona hotel offers a restaurant, outdoor BBQ area, and access to various outdoor activities including hiking and fishing.
Rooms & Amenities
The resort's creekhomes provide spacious accommodations equipped with fully equipped kitchens and luxurious amenities. Each unit features a private wraparound deck with scenic views, allowing guests to enjoy the breathtaking nature surrounding Junipine Resort.
Dining Experience
The Table at Junipine offers a unique dining experience in a rustic atmosphere, showcasing seasonal menus with locally sourced ingredients. Guests can savor salads, handcrafted pizzas, and signature entrees, complemented by wines and locally made craft beers.
Leisure & Activities
Junipine Resort is close to West Fork Trail and Slide Rock State Park, ideal for hiking and exploring the outdoors. The property also features charging stations for electric vehicles, ensuring convenient access for eco-conscious travelers.
Event Facilities
The resort provides diverse options for private events, with stunning creekside patios catering to gatherings of up to 100 guests. This setting is also perfect for intimate weddings or family reunions, making Junipine Resort a versatile choice for celebrations.

Dining Onsite
The Table at Junipine Resort invites guests to experience the heart of Sedona through American cuisine inspired by local flavors and seasonal ingredients. Utilizing produce from the resort's own garden and ethically sourced meats and seafood, every meal is a celebration of the region's bounty, served in a cozy and inviting atmosphere.
The Table
American
Ambiance
Set in a warm and inviting indoor space that reflects the beauty of Sedona, The Table offers a relaxed dining experience with views of the surrounding landscape.
Key Offerings
Savor dishes crafted from wild foods unique to Arizona, alongside fresh produce from the resort's garden. The menu highlights ethically sourced meats and seafood, promising an authentic taste of the region.
Reservation
Reservations recommended.
Open Wednesday to Sunday from 11:00 AM to 8:00 PM.
